Output 37328c82ef28c9711840b27d07cfef9465cda96ac7d880d709e325f7fd252b97:3

value
616514132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7661241aca93f863ca84524d831eaf2f3610c0cb OP_EQUAL
address
MJh6LYUhMxdRp9npXXY2M4m3ETSfzCJWb6
transaction
37328c82ef28c9711840b27d07cfef9465cda96ac7d880d709e325f7fd252b97
spent
true